A história se passa na Sicília, durante a Segunda Guerra Mundial e o período pós-guerra. O filme narra a relação entre Salvatore Di Vita, um jovem apaixonado por cinema, e Alfredo, o projectionista do cinema local, Cinema Paradiso. Salvatore (apelidado de Sal) passa a maior parte de sua infância e adolescência no cinema, onde Alfredo se torna uma figura paterna para ele. Juntos, eles vivenciam a magia do cinema e enfrentam as adversidades da vida.

El viaje de Cinema Paradiso hacia el éxito no fue sencillo. En su estreno inicial en Italia, la película tenía una duración cercana a las tres horas y fue un fracaso rotundo en taquilla. Desesperado, el productor Franco Cristaldi obligó a Tornatore a recortar casi una hora de metraje para su distribución internacional.
